Confrontation with a Ballistic Missile.. Death Toll from Israel's Attack on Sana'a Rises to 9 Victims
SadaNews - The death toll from the Israeli aggression on the Yemeni capital, Sana'a, rose to 9 martyrs as of last Thursday evening.
According to the Health Ministry affiliated with the Houthi group, the number is expected to rise, noting that search operations for the missing are still ongoing.
It was indicated that there are 174 injured individuals receiving treatment in hospitals, some of whom are in critical condition.
The Israeli army attacked several targets in Sana'a, claiming they were military objectives, while the Houthis denied this, asserting that they targeted civilian neighborhoods.
Israeli Defense Minister Israel Katz vowed to continue attacks against the Houthis after their escalation of strikes against Israel.
Following these attacks, the Houthis launched a missile towards Israel, which announced that it successfully intercepted it.
Hundreds of thousands of Israelis in Jerusalem and Tel Aviv rushed to shelters, while air traffic at Ben Gurion Airport was halted for a few minutes.
